NOTE 16: Retirement Plans
Post-retirement Healthcare Plans
We provide post-retirement medical benefits to certain eligible employees. These plans are unfunded and provide differing levels
of healthcare benefits dependent upon hire date and work location. Not all of our employees are covered by these plans at
December 31, 2014.
The following table sets forth the changes in the benefit obligation and plan assets of our post-retirement healthcare plans for the
years ended December 31, 2014 and 2013:

Benefit payments, which reflect expected future service, are expected to be paid as follows: $1.8 million in 2015; $1.7 million in
2016; $1.7 million in 2017; $1.8 million in 2018; $1.8 million in 2019; and $9.9 million in 2020 through 2024.
